XAudio2_7.dllが原因でゲームが強制終了してしまう時の対処法

Windows10にアップグレードしたら、特定のPCゲームをプレイしていると10分ぐらいでフリーズ&強制終了。これは困ったなと調べてゆくと、どうやらXAudio2_7.dllというファイルの読み込みに不具合が起こっているらしい。

この方法で改善したので忘れないようにメモ。

  1. Win10の「Cortana」に『pe』と入力し、『パフォーマンスモニタ』を起動
  2. パフォーマンスモニタ左側にある「モニターツール」を右クリックし、『システム信頼性の表示』をクリック
  3. 信頼性モニター画面で、「重要なイベント」から『落ちるソフト名』をダブルクリック
  4. 問題の詳細画面で『障害モジュールの名前』を確認 『XAudio2_7.dll_unloaded』となっていたら次のステップへ
  5. Ctrl+Alt+Delを押し「タスクマネージャー」を起動し、『サービス』のタブをクリック
  6. 「名前」の欄から『TabletInputService』を探し、右クリックから『停止』を選択。 再び右クリックし『サービス管理ツールを開く』をクリック
  7. 「サービス」一覧の「名前」から『Touch Keyboad and handwriting panel service』を探し、右クリックから『プロパティ』を選択
  8. 「スタートアップの種類」を『無効』。「サービスの状態」を『停止』に設定。

タブレットや、モニタなどのタッチデバイス用の機能を無効化しているという感じみたい。 Win10をアップデートすると、まれにこの設定が初期化されてしまうようなので、再び無効化する設定が必要。


page top